“…Anthocyanin level was lower as in other cell culture systems like rabbiteye blueberry (Nawa et al, 1993). Higher sucrose levels and lower nitrate levels enhanced anthocyanin accumulation in parallel with other cell culture systems like grapes (Do and Cormier, 1991;Hirasuna et al, 1991). Previous studies in our lab- oratory have indicated that higher sucrose levels were necessary to induce anthocyanin production in cranberry cultures (Madhavi et al, 1993).…”

“…The effect of NH 4 ? :NO 3 -ratio on the growth kinetics of cells and their secondary metabolism with phenolic structure for some cell cultures has been reported (Do and Cormier 1991;Hirasuna et al 1991;Srinivasan and Ryn 1993) including the production of RA by Anchusa officinalis (De-Eknamkul and Ellis 1985) and Lavandula vera (Ilieva and Pavlov 1999). Usually the start of the biosynthesis of secondary metabolites is related to comparatively low levels of nitrogen in the medium.…”
